Speaker of Kebbi assembly, Ankwai, dies

The Speaker of the Kebbi State House of Assembly, Hon. Muhammad Usman Ankwai, has died, triggering an outpouring of grief across the state.

Circumstances surrounding his death remained unclear as of press time.

Ankwai, who represented the Zuru Constituency, was Speaker of the 10th Kebbi State House of Assembly.

His death has drawn condolences from colleagues, political associates, and residents across Kebbi State.
